The New Jersey form requirement

NJ-BWSE-CITR

New Jersey requires NJDEP form BWSE-CITR-IQ — BackflowGo fills the official PDF for you.

New Jersey physical connections are tested QUARTERLY on NJDEP form BWSE-CITR-IQ. Mail the completed form to the water supplier AND the local Administrative Authority (health board) within 5 days of the test; it goes to NJDEP only with permit applications/renewals (N.J.A.C. 7:10-10).
